What's the oldest human-made thing I can buy, just to have? I really want to own something that is hundreds or thousands of years old.
I would like to have a very old item, just for the sake of reflecting on history and humanity and as a conversation piece.
Requirements:
-Under $500, although less expensive is better.
-Smaller is better (I have a small living space).
Bonus points for recommendations of where to buy whatever it is you're recommending.
I'm thinking a coin is the most obvious, but am open to other suggestions and also to suggestions for a specific coin if there is some particular coin that is recognized to be the oldest common coin or something like that. |
